Can you explain what structured cloning is in JavaScript?
Structured cloning is a method for creating a deep copy of objects in JavaScript, allowing complex data types to be copied.
What types of data can be cloned using structured cloning?
You can clone objects, arrays, dates, maps, sets, and even typed arrays using structured cloning.
How does structured cloning differ from shallow copying?
Structured cloning creates a deep copy, meaning nested objects are also copied, while shallow copying only copies references.
Can you give an example of using structured cloning?
Sure! You can use the structuredClone()
function to clone an object: const clone = structuredClone(originalObject);
.
